分发网络(CDN)的不同与联系

在云计算和大数据时代,数据的存储和快速访问是每一个应用追求的目标,对象存储(Object Storage)和内容分发网络(Content Delivery Network,简称CDN)作为两种优化数据存取和访问的技术,它们各自的特点和联合使用的优势成为了互联网技术发展中不可或缺的一部分。
对象存储的概述
对象存储是一种存储架构,它允许数据以“对象”形式存放,每个对象包括数据、元数据和全局唯一标识符,这种存储方式具有高可扩展性,适用于处理非结构化数据,如图片、视频等,对象存储通过分离数据通道和控制通路来提高存取性能,同时提供类似文件存储的共享便利。
CDN的工作原理与应用
CDN是一个由多个分布在不同地理位置的节点组成的分布式网络,旨在将内容高效地分发给用户,通过在用户附近的节点缓存内容,CDN减少了数据传输距离和时间,提高了访问速度,CDN主要针对静态资源的访问加速,如静态网页、图片、视频等。
对象存储与CDN的结合使用
对象存储和CDN通常会配合使用,对象存储负责数据的安全可靠存储,而CDN则负责将这些数据快速分发给最终用户,当用户请求某个资源时,CDN会将请求重定向到最近的边缘节点,如果该节点没有缓存所需内容,则会从对象存储中获取并缓存至边缘节点,然后返回给用户。
关键技术和应用场景

缓存策略:CDN的性能在很大程度上依赖于其缓存策略,如最近最少使用(LRU)和最不经常使用(LFU)策略等。
数据安全性:为了保护数据安全,CDN和对象存储均采取了数据加密、访问控制和数据备份恢复等措施。
扩展性:随着业务量的增长,CDN和对象存储需要支持灵活扩展存储容量和性能,通常采用分布式存储和可伸缩架构来实现。
相关问题与解答
1、如何选择合适的对象存储和CDN服务?
在选择对象存储和CDN服务时,应考虑数据类型、访问频率、预算以及服务质量等因素,对于需要频繁访问的热数据,应选择响应速度快的CDN服务;而对于冷数据,更关心存储成本的对象存储更为合适。
2、对象存储和CDN在安全性方面有哪些保障措施?
对象存储和CDN都采取了多种安全措施来保护数据,包括但不限于数据加密传输、访问权限控制、DDoS防护以及数据备份和恢复,这些措施确保了数据在存储和传输过程中的安全性和可靠性。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复